The Food and Nutrition Service administers the WIC program at the federal level; state agencies are responsible for determining participant eligibility and providing benefits and services, and for authorizing vendors. The WIC food packages provide supplemental foods designed to address the specific nutritional needs of income-eligible pregnant, breastfeeding, and non-breastfeeding postpartum individuals, infants, and children up to five years of age who are at nutritional risk. WIC participants receive a monthly benefit from one of seven science-based food ...The Special Supplemental Nutrition Program for Women, Infants, and Children (WIC) helps families stay healthy by providing: Nutrition education; Breastfeeding support; Healthy foods; Referrals to health services and other resources.
